Job Description
The Director of Origination at Nexamp will lead and develop a high-performing team responsible for identifying project sites and securing site control opportunities in the clean energy sector, while implementing effective origination strategies to drive company growth.
Responsibilities
- •Build, lead, manage and develop an Origination team to meet growth objectives.
- •Leverage internal platforms and technology tools to optimize sales processes.
- •Develop and manage personnel training and development strategies.
- •Establish resource allocation plans and tailor origination strategies.
- •Enforce data management and compliance standards across the team.
- •Manage external lead referral partners to support origination efforts.
